How Crowded Is Little Rock Central High School National Historic Site in November?
November runs about 1× Little Rock Central High School National Historic Site's average month, which makes it an average month here — roughly 8% of the park's yearly visitors come in November.
In a typical November the park sees roughly 9,600 recreation visits, based on National Park Service monthly counts from 2001 to 2025.
That makes November the 8th-busiest of the park's twelve months, sitting between the July peak (1.3×) and the January low (0.6×).
On our Best Time to Visit score November rates 41/100 ("Poor"), versus the top-rated September at 58/100 — pleasant weather with noticeably thinner crowds (shoulder season).
Typical November weather, from 1991–2020 NOAA climate normals at the nearest station, averages a daytime high near 62°F and an overnight low around 40°F, with about 4.7" of precipitation.
That average of about 51°F is a comfortable range for hiking and being outdoors all day.
Because June, July and August together draw about 27% of annual visitors, choosing November instead steps outside that summer crush — the single biggest lever on how crowded the park feels.
You'll have about 10.1 hours of daylight in November to explore — between the 9.7-hour midwinter low and the 14.3-hour summer high.
Park-wide, 2024 drew 63,767 recreation visits, up 8.9% from 58,571 in 2023.
Across the past decade overall visitation has eased about 32.2%, so November may feel a touch quieter than it once did.
